Location: New York
Location - Midtown Manhattan - 4-5 days in-office
OverviewWe are seeking a highly organized and detail-oriented Executive Assistant to support senior leadership with a primary focus on interview scheduling and candidate coordination
. This role is critical to ensuring a seamless, professional experience for candidates, clients, and internal stakeholders by managing complex calendars, coordinating interviews across multiple time zones, and maintaining clear, proactive communication.
The ideal candidate thrives in a fast-paced environment, is meticulous with details, and excels at juggling priorities while maintaining a polished and professional demeanor.
Key Responsibilities- Interview Scheduling & Coordination
- Coordinate and schedule high-volume interviews across multiple stakeholders, including executives, hiring managers, candidates, and clients
- Manage complex calendars
, often with last-minute changes or competing priorities - Schedule virtual, in-person, and multi-round interview processes
- Handle rescheduling, cancellations, and urgent changes with professionalism and speed
- Prepare and send interview confirmations, calendar invites, agendas, and logistics
- Ensure candidates receive timely instructions, links, and directions
- Partner closely with internal teams to align availability and priorities
- Identify opportunities to improve scheduling workflows and efficiency
- Maintain a high-touch, white-glove candidate experience
- Ensure consistency, accuracy, and professionalism in all communications
- Provide day-to-day administrative support to senior executives or recruiters
- Act as a primary point of contact for scheduling-related communication
- Track interview status and maintain accurate scheduling records
- Support meeting preparation, follow-ups, and documentation as needed
- Maintain confidentiality and discretion with sensitive information
2+ years of admin and/or scheduling experience
